The 7-foot-long dog is now in stores and online.
Fans of Home Depot’s 12-foot skeletons are flocking to Home Depot for the very first companion for the spooky giants: A 7-foot-long Skelly Dog.The adorable pup has changeable, light-up puppy-dog eyes and can be posed to look like he’s wagging his skele-tail.
The website description says: “The Home Depot introduces the 12 ft. Skeleton’s best friend, 7 ft. Skelly’s Dog. Its LCD LifeEyes light up and allow you to choose between 8 different LCD animation displays such as hearts, fireworks, flames and other eye designs, they also move and blink, just like their 12 ft. friend.”The dog is 7 feet from nose to tail and nearly 5 feet high. It has poseable features “such as a jaw and a tail that can be positioned to preference.
It takes about half an hour to set up Skelly Dog. He is operated by battery and has a plug-in power adapter. The review section on the website shows customers already assembling and displaying Skelly Dogs, with one dressed in pink bows and tutu with a personalized collar, and another beside a kiddie pool wearing a shark float.
